Kitchen Supervisor - Casino supervises kitchen personnel and food preparation. Ensures a high level of food quality, cleanliness, and customer satisfaction. Being a Kitchen Supervisor - Casino may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ager. The Kitchen Supervisor - Casino sup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. To be a Kitchen Supervisor - Casino typ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
